Robert Runs in Lightning Meet

The Lightning Meet is held at Sacred Heart (all girls school) right after school on Friday and continues on Saturday.  Robert is scheduled to run the 4x800 with Nick Bierne, Robert, Ian Forbes, and Logan Otter and run the 1600 meter on Friday, and if he can - he will run the 3200 meter run on Saturday, but he has a soccer game on Saturday (and we said soccer comes first).

Unfortunately for Robert, he didn't eat when he got home from school, and by the time I got home it was time to leave for the meet.  I offered to get him some "fast food" but he didn't want it.  Well, the bad news is that he got car sick on the short ride from home to the meet.  I got him a pretzel as soon as we got there.

To make it worse, his event - the 4x800 is the first event of the night and boys are starting.  He was rushing to warm up, then rushing to get ready and get to the line.  They made it but then couldn't find Ian.  Finally all 4 boys are there!  They had a fabulous run!  Nick was the lead off and maintained the lead, Robert kept the lead but the the other runners are closing in, we lost the lead with Ian but only by a little bit, then Logan finished it off - taking the lead for 1st place.  The 4x800 team finished with a time of 10:30.55.  SUPER!!!




Well, Robert is feeling better.  He felt that he could have done better on the 4x800 but wasn't sure while he was running.  Not to worry!

The next race is a while off so I had Robert get some food and settle down after a cool down.  He will be running the mile with Nick Bierne.  The mile didn't start until 8:00 pm.  The night was getting cooler.  Every 10 minutes I would have to remind Robert, Nick and Grace to keep warm, keep loose!


Finally they got to run.  Four laps.  Robert didn't get a great start but he made up time and place on each lap.  He finished right behind Nick Bierne in 8th place with a time of 5:39.  After he finished he said he had a lot more energy and should have pushed harder on the 3rd lap.

I think he did great especially considering he wasn't feeling very good before the race!
